Why Get Pre-Approved for a Car Loan?
Know Your Budget Before You Shop
One of the biggest advantages of getting pre-approved for a car loan is knowing exactly how much you can afford to spend on a vehicle before you start shopping. With a pre-approval in hand, you'll have a clear idea of your budget based on the loan amount you qualify for. This helps you narrow down your car search to vehicles that fit within your price range, saving you time and preventing disappointment.
Having a defined budget also allows you to plan ahead for your monthly car payments. You can use an auto loan calculator to estimate your monthly payments based on your pre-approved loan amount, interest rate, and loan term. This way, you can ensure that your car payments fit comfortably into your overall budget.

Negotiate Like a Cash Buyer
When you walk into a dealership with a pre-approved car loan, you're essentially a cash buyer. This puts you in a stronger negotiating position, as dealers are often more willing to offer competitive prices to buyers who have their financing sorted out. You can focus on negotiating the best price for the car itself, rather than getting caught up in complex financing discussions.
Having pre-approval also means you're less likely to be swayed by dealership financing incentives that may not be in your best interest. Dealers often offer their own financing options, but these may come with higher interest rates or less favorable terms compared to the pre-approved loan you secured from an outside lender.
Streamline the Car Buying Process
Getting pre-approved for a car loan can save you valuable time when you're ready to make a purchase. With financing already in place, you can shop with confidence and make a decision more quickly when you find the right car. You won't need to spend hours at the dealership filling out financing applications or waiting for loan approval.
Pre-approval also simplifies the paperwork involved in the car buying process. Since you've already provided your financial information and been approved for a specific loan amount, there's less back-and-forth needed between you, the dealer, and the lender. This can help you close the deal and drive off in your new car more efficiently.

How to Get Pre-Approved for a Car Loan
Check Your Credit Score
Before applying for pre-approval, it's essential to check your credit score. Your credit score is one of the main factors lenders consider when evaluating your loan application. A higher credit score generally means you're more likely to be approved for a loan and may qualify for better interest rates.
You can obtain a free credit report once a year from each of the three major credit bureaus in Australia: Equifax, Experian, and illion. Review your credit report for any errors or inaccuracies that could negatively impact your score, and take steps to correct them before applying for pre-approval.
Gather Necessary Documents
When you're ready to apply for pre-approval, you'll need to provide some basic information and documentation to the lender. This typically includes:
- Personal identification (e.g., driver's license, passport)
- Proof of income (e.g., pay stubs, tax returns)
- Employment details (e.g., employer name, length of employment)
- Residential information (e.g., address, mortgage/rent payments)
- Existing debts and financial obligations
Having these documents readily available can help streamline the pre-approval process and increase your chances of a quick approval decision.
Apply with Multiple Lenders
It's a good idea to apply for pre-approval with multiple lenders to compare offers and find the best deal. Different lenders may have varying loan terms, interest rates, and fees, so shopping around can help you secure the most favorable financing package.
When applying with multiple lenders, aim to do so within a short time frame, typically within 14-45 days. Multiple hard credit inquiries within this window are generally treated as a single inquiry, minimizing the impact on your credit score.

What to Consider When Getting Pre-Approved
Loan Terms and Interest Rates
When comparing pre-approval offers from different lenders, pay close attention to the loan terms and interest rates. A lower interest rate can save you money over the life of the loan, but also consider the length of the loan term. A longer loan term may lower your monthly payments but could result in paying more interest overall.
Look for loans with competitive interest rates and terms that align with your financial goals and budget. Don't be afraid to negotiate with lenders or ask about any special promotions or discounts that could help you secure a better rate.
Down Payment Amount
The size of your down payment can impact your pre-approval amount and the overall cost of your car loan. A larger down payment reduces the amount you need to borrow, which can lead to lower monthly payments and less interest paid over the life of the loan.
Aim to save up as much as possible for a down payment before applying for pre-approval. A down payment of 20% or more is ideal, but even smaller amounts can make a difference in your financing terms.

Vehicle Type and Age Restrictions
Some lenders may have restrictions on the type or age of vehicle you can finance with a pre-approved loan. For example, they may not offer loans for certain makes or models, or they may have age limits on used cars.
When getting pre-approved, ask about any vehicle restrictions upfront so you can plan your car search accordingly. If you have a specific vehicle in mind, check with the lender to ensure it meets their financing criteria before making a purchase.

FAQ
How long does pre-approval take?
The pre-approval process can vary depending on the lender, but it typically takes anywhere from a few hours to a few days. Some lenders offer instant pre-approval decisions online, while others may require more time to review your application.
What if I'm pre-approved but then denied financing?
Pre-approval is a conditional approval based on the information you provide upfront. If your financial circumstances change between pre-approval and final loan approval, or if the lender finds discrepancies in your application, there's a chance you could be denied financing. To avoid this, be honest and accurate in your pre-approval application and maintain your financial standing until your loan is finalized.
Can I get pre-approved for a car loan with bad credit?
While it may be more challenging, it is possible to get pre-approved for a car loan with bad credit. Some lenders specialize in working with borrowers with less-than-perfect credit. However, keep in mind that you may face higher interest rates and less favorable loan terms compared to borrowers with good credit.
